She was the youngest child in an unusual family; her father, Thomas, was 65 years old at the time of her birth, while her mother, Ann, was, at 16, still a minor. The family was below the poverty line, and Christine did not receive the necessary early childhood support. Because of this, she was considered mentally challenged; she also had epilepsy and was also obese. To make matters worse, her parents also physically and sexually abused her. She required a regular dose of medication to control her epileptic seizures.

The insurance money was a factor for Teresa, but by walking away from the church, Randy took her farther away from David.
She no longer would work in the church kitchen, attend choir rehearsals, or other David’s sermons stir the congregation on Sunday mornings.
Randy also knew, or suspected, enough to possibly crash David Love’s future. His financial questions could get David fired from New Hope. And if he acted on suspicions of his wife’s affair, Randy could wreck any hope that David Love would work again as a Baptist pastor.
Whether or not he realized it, Randy Stone had become the greatest threat to David Love’s happiness and livelihood.
